2) Pool size and shape decide how your days actually feel

Some private pools are made for photos—small, shaded, and more “plunge” than “swim.” That can be fine for couples who are out all day, but it often disappoints groups and families who plan to spend real time at the villa.

When comparing villas, ask two simple questions:

Can I properly swim?
Can we comfortably lounge as a group?

4) Seminyak is all about walkability (and it’s worth prioritising)

You can find private pool villas all over Bali. The reason people specify Seminyak is lifestyle: the beach vibe, dining options, boutique shopping, and the sense that everything is close enough to be easy.

That’s why location within Seminyak matters more than many travellers realise. A villa can technically be “Seminyak,” but if you need transport for every meal, the trip turns into constant planning.

10) A quick checklist for booking a “private pool villa” you’ll love

Before you commit, run this checklist (it takes five minutes and saves so many regrets):

Pool

  • Is the pool size listed (not just “private pool”)?
  • Is there a comfortable deck with loungers + shade?
  • Can you access it easily from living spaces?

Layout

  • Is there a big social hub (living + dining + pool)?
  • Are there multiple zones so the group can spread out?

Staff

  • Is there a villa manager (not just “housekeeping”)?
  • Is security mentioned?
  • Is there cooking support if you want it?

Location

  • Can you walk to beach + dining, or are you taxi-dependent?

Villa days

  • Wi-Fi quality?
  • Entertainment for chill afternoons?
